"suraddition" meaning in English

See suraddition in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

Forms: suradditions [plural]
Etymology: From French suraddition. Etymology templates: {{bor|en|fr|suraddition}} French suraddition Head templates: {{en-noun}} suraddition (plural suradditions)
  1. (obsolete, rare) Something added or appended, as to a name. Tags: obsolete, rare Synonyms: superaddition
